Output 57b6d7df4e52aa4b86b0f5bd46c4f5785a67b4d791c4e06ccd703cdf433a286a: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fea4e980efb408cf8a3c93674d84f632a66efc9 OP_EQUAL
address
3KBmg7tpCxsNJYWk4VG42qMejdnhAWqDN8
transaction
57b6d7df4e52aa4b86b0f5bd46c4f5785a67b4d791c4e06ccd703cdf433a286a
confirmations
456977
spent
true